LaSalle launches parks, recreation, and culture master plan initiative

By Saeed Akhtar, Local Journalism Initiative Reporter, Lakeshore News Reporter

The Town of LaSalle has announced the development of a Parks, Recreation, and Culture Master Plan, a comprehensive strategy to shape the town’s recreational and cultural amenities for the next five years and beyond.

The plan aims to meet the evolving needs of all residents, with a vision extending to 2050, when LaSalle’s population is projected to reach 50,000.

The Master Plan will focus on various areas, including indoor recreation facilities such as arenas, pools, and gymnasiums; outdoor facilities like sports fields, playgrounds, and splash pads; parks and open spaces; cultural facilities; and program and service delivery.

“We want to know how you use parks, recreation, and cultural facilities, and how we can improve public spaces, services, and programs for current and future generations,” said Patti Funaro, Director of Culture and Recreation.

Community engagement will play a key role in shaping the plan, and opportunities for residents to share their input will begin soon.
